Description:

This is inspired by the idea of blind envelope swaps I've seen hosted by @thisismeAXiD with a small twist.

I love receiving a filled envelope and discovering all of the assorted goodies within. If you are anything like me you will definitely love this swap. You will have 1 partner to whom you'll send a blind envie (meaning you pack before partners are assigned and seal the envelope) of 10 categories of items from the following list (each bullet point=1category)

  • 5 Handmade crafts (not by anyone else, you need to make something for your partner) It can be anything, some options are bookmark, flip card, pocket folder, ATC, notecard, bracelet, and so on.
  • 5 envelopes (not smaller than 4x4)
  • 5 quotes (handwritten or typed)
  • 5 paperclips(altered or different designs but not plain)
  • 5 scrapbooking papers (6x6 or bigger )
  • 5 tags
  • 5 wax seals (real wax not stickers)
  • 5 photographs (instax or regular)
  • 5 book pages (whole sheets not cut or torn, slightly worn out is fine)
  • 5 washi samples (24" each)
  • 5 ribbon/lace samples (24" each)
  • 5 patterned fabric squares (4x4 or bigger)
  • 5 different papers (for junk journal)
  • 5 paper doilies (each 3" or bigger)
  • 10 ephemera
  • 10 loose stickers (each 1" or bigger) or 1 sheet with 10 stickers
  • 10 used postage stamps
  • 10 negative films
  • 10 die cuts
  • 10 memo sheets/sticky notes (each 3" or bigger)
  • 10 stamped images (each 2" or bigger)
  • 10 dried flowers (packed neatly in an envelope)

Along with it send a little note of the swap name, your swapbot ID and list the 10 categories you are including. You can include any extras if you so wish (we all know we love them). Since this is an international swap, please give the mail adequate time to reach you. Making it a type 3 due to craft element and postage costs.
